Jeremiah 32:18

who shows mercy (caring love – Hebr. chesed) to thousands and repays the sins of the fathers in the bosom of their sons after them. God (El) the great, the mighty, the Lord of hosts (Yahweh Sebaot) is his name.

The hebrew text BETA

Hebrew Masoretic text (MA), Read from right to left

עֹשֶׂה   חֶסֶד   לַאֲלָפִים   וּמְשַׁלֵּם   עֲוֹן   אָבוֹת   אֶל   חֵיק   בְּנֵיהֶם   אַחֲרֵיהֶם   הָאֵל   הַגָּדוֹל   הַגִּבּוֹר   יְהוָה   צְבָאוֹת   שְׁמוֹ  

Greek Septuagint (LXX), Read from left to right

ποιῶν ἔλεος εἰς χιλιάδας καὶ ἀποδιδοὺς ἁμαρτίας πατέρων εἰς κόλπους τέκνων αὐτῶν μετ᾽ αὐτούς ὁ θεὸς ὁ μέγας καὶ ἰσχυρός
